Overview
Explore the subject that fits your interests and ambition with 2 tracks to choose from. The General track equips you with up-to-date knowledge of international finance across various finance disciplines. Are you a finance professional with an affinity for IT and innovation and are you eager to use technology to your advantage? Then our Finance and Technology track is for you. Whichever the track you choose, you will earn the same MSc degree in International Finance.

Programme Structure
Courses include:
- Advanced Corporate Finance and Valuation
- Financial Analysis and Valuation
- Financial Econometrics
- Financial Modelling
- Financial Derivatives
- Investments & Algorithmic Trading

General requirements
- A degree from a recognised research university in a related field
- A minimum of 2 years' relevant post-graduate full-time work experience
- A proof of analytical skills, e.g. GMAT, GRE or Executive Assessment
- Passport copy
- 1-page CV
- Motivation statement. In the application form we ask you to answer 4 short questions about your motivation and decision for applying to the programme
- Copies of transcripts and related diplomas from your highest completed degree. All transcripts not in Dutch or English must be accompanied by a certified English translation
- English proficiency test results: TOEFL/IELTS
